Welcome to Morton County, Kansas. This hidden gem in the heart of the Sunflower State is a destination worth adding to your travel bucket list. Although it may be small and often overlooked, this county has plenty of charm and unique experiences waiting for you.
First, let's dive into the history of Morton County. Named after Oliver P. Morton, an influential politician from Indiana, this county was established in 1886 as part of the Wild West era. Rich with tales from pioneers and cowboys alike, its past still echoes through its vast landscapes.
One thing that sets Morton County apart is its striking natural beauty. The expansive grasslands stretch out before you like a patchwork quilt stitched by Mother Nature herself. These prairies are home to a wide variety of wildlife species such as pronghorn antelope and coyotes - perfect for those who want to get closer to nature.
